Tips for Booking Hotels in Cuba
-
Book early for peak seasons: December–April is Cuba’s most popular travel window.
-
Choose location based on interests: Beach resorts are best in Varadero and the Cayos; city stays are ideal in Havana.
-
Understand hotel categories: Some Cuban hotels may feel dated compared to other Caribbean luxury resorts, but many combine classic charm with local culture.
Frequently Asked Questions About Hotels in Cuba
1. What is the best area to stay in Cuba?
For beaches, Varadero, Cayo Coco, and Cayo Santa María are top choices; for culture and nightlife, Havana, especially Vedado and Old Havana, is ideal.
2. Are Cuban hotels luxurious?
Some are high-end with all-inclusive resorts and beachfront amenities, while others offer historic charm and classic comforts. International chains like Meliá and Iberostar manage many top properties.
3. Is it safe to stay in hotels in Cuba?
Many travelers enjoy stays in well-reviewed hotels; just take normal travel precautions and research areas before you go.
